What is golf course accounting?

A Golf Course Accounting job involves managing the financial transactions, budgeting, and reporting for a golf course facility. Responsibilities typically include tracking revenue from memberships, green fees, and pro shop sales, as well as managing payroll, expenses, and financial compliance. Accountants in this role ensure accurate financial records, assist with financial planning, and may work with management to optimize profitability. This role requires knowledge of accounting principles, industry-specific financial practices, and proficiency in accounting software.

What are the typical responsibilities of someone working in golf course accounting?

Professionals in Golf Course Accounting are responsible for managing accounts payable and receivable, processing payroll, preparing monthly financial statements, and overseeing budgeting for golf course operations. They often work closely with the general manager, pro shop staff, and groundskeeping teams to track expenses and support financial planning. In addition to routine bookkeeping, the role may involve auditing daily sales from the club house and handling membership billing or special event finances. This position offers a varied work environment where accuracy and collaboration are key. Over time, there may be opportunities to advance into senior finance roles or broader club management positions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in golf course accounting, and why are they important?

To thrive in Golf Course Accounting, you need a strong understanding of accounting principles, financial reporting, and budgeting, usually backed by an accounting degree or relevant experience. Familiarity with accounting software such as QuickBooks, point-of-sale systems, and golf course management platforms is typically required, and a CPA certification can be an asset. Exceptional attention to detail, organizational skills, and the ability to communicate effectively with staff and management are valuable soft skills in this position. These competencies are crucial for ensuring accurate financial management, supporting operational decisions, and maintaining the financial health of the golf course.
